I learned the trick with those phalanxes is to flank, flank and flank again! Once they lower their pikes or spears into a combat position they are very slow and unmanouvreable and they eave their flanks exposed. If you can mass against the flank of one the phalanxes and break it then rally your men and attack the next flank and so on and you can roll up the whole line.

Infact thats actally how the Romans learned to deal with the Macedonians in RL. Its a testament to how good RTW is that RL tactics work just as well in the game.

Head to head with a phalanx and you'll find yourself running through the green fields of Elysium 'as quick as boiled asparagus' as the Emperor Augustus used to say!
